Leaping Into 2020: Member Event and Lunch

February 26, 2020, 12:00 pm to 2:00 pm

Dodson Room, Irving K. Barber Learning Centre

RSVP (dietary requirements)

Join Language Sciences for lunch and a leap into the new year!

Every member is invited to attend, as well as anyone studying language in a scientific way, or working in language-related areas. Hear about Language Sciences' updates, including funding news and plans for the year, while munching some dejeuner. In addition, hear three flash talks by members Drs. Anne Murphy, Carla Hudson Kam, and  Anja-Xiaoxing Cui. 

This event is free but please RSVP via the link above so we can get a sense of numbers for catering.
